If you enable gps on your phone the gps receiver will work when an app that uses gps needs it to locate your phone. Many apps use gps - the most common being satellite navigation apps.
To use GPS you need an appropriate GPS app, dozens of which are available in Play Store, ranging from basic GPS status apps to full blown mapping & navigation apps.
Probably the best known is Google Maps, which by virtue of being a Google product is to be found on all Android devices.
You will find that most apps are free to download, some with paid for options, which remove ads and/or provide additional functionality.
Depending on what you want to use GPS for, you will almost certainly find apps to achieve it.
